# Break-Glass: Catalog Cache Invalidation

Scope: the Pinrow product catalog at Veldstone Retail. If stale prices persist after a purge and the Hollowmere invalidation queue is wedged, use break-glass to flush the edge tier directly. Contractors: get verbal sign-off from the catalog lead first. Steps: open the Hollowmere admin shell, select emergency-flush, confirm the tenant, and run it once — repeated flushes thrash the origin. Access is logged and expires after 20 minutes. Unseal the admin shell with the passphrase below.

recovery phrase for kahop-tajog: istix-casvan

Runbook: Orvex Kiosk Watchdog. If a kiosk freezes, the watchdog restarts the shell after three missed heartbeats; a fourth miss triggers a full device reboot. Release manager: do not ship builds that alter heartbeat cadence without updating fleet policy first, or kiosks will flap overnight. To verify watchdog health, check the restart counter in the fleet console; anything above five per day per unit means the new build is unstable. The watchdog runs with these configuration values.

service settings:
WENATH_PIN=5007
WENATH_METRICS_HOST=metrics.wenath.tolvaqlabs.corp
WENATH_LOG_LEVEL=debug
WENATH_TENANT=rusox

# Env file — Cartwheel dispatch, driver-assignment heuristic
# Scope: staging only. Do not promote to prod.
# The heuristic weights (proximity, shift balance, refusal rate) are tuned
# for the Velmont pilot region and will misbehave elsewhere.
# Review notes: heuristic service runs unprivileged; it reads weights
# read-only from the tuning store and writes nothing back.
# Only one sensitive value exists in this file: the tuning-store access
# credential, consumed at boot and never logged.
# That credential is set on the following line.

secret setting of faduf-bahop: LEDGER_TOKEN8=c3b363be

Ticket: Audio-guide sync failing — expired creds

Heads up: the Murrelet museum audio-guide app stopped pulling exhibit narration overnight because the content-sync service credential expired. I've swapped in a fresh one and bumped the config version; please double-check I didn't miss a cached copy in the deploy scripts. For reference during review, the new key for the content-sync service is below.

app token of yajof-fajof = zpat11_OrsDd3gqCaG